Specialty Logic NXP Semiconductors 74ABT899DB,112 Overview

The NXP Semiconductors 74ABT899DB,112 is a precision-engineered Integrated Circuit (IC) specifically designed for high-performance data transmission applications. This IC, part of the Specialty Logic category, is known for its robustness and reliability in complex digital environments. The dual 9-bit latch transceiver configuration ensures seamless data flow between data buses, minimizing signal degradation and improving system integrity. With its small form factor SSOP (Shrink Small Outline Package) 28-pin configuration, it offers a compact solution for dense circuit designs, making it an essential component for manufacturers aiming to optimize space without compromising on performance.
